Not sure if this turned into COVID whether by mutation or is variant of? Is there a doctor or scientist here?

Excerpt: "Baric and his team demonstrated that the newly-identified SARS-like virus, labeled SHC014-CoV and found in the Chinese horseshoe bats, can jump between bats and humans by showing that the virus can latch onto and use the same human and bat receptor for entry. The virus also replicates as well as SARS-CoV in primary human lung cells, the preferred target for infection."

November 9, 2015
https://sph.unc.edu/sph-news/new-sars-l ... available/

“This virus is highly pathogenic, and treatments developed against the original SARS virus in 2002 and the ZMapp drugs used to fight Ebola fail to neutralize and control this particular virus,” said Baric. “So building resources, rather than limiting them, to both examine animal populations for new threats and develop therapeutics is key for limiting future outbreaks.”

I Googled the virus name, and came up with a Wikipedia article:
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/SHC014-CoV

This bat virus has not infected any humans. It was shown, after genetic modification, to be able to infect human cells in a test tube. These type of lab experiments might be exactly the kind that led to SARS-Cov2. They must be carried out in BL4 Labs (the highest biohazard level), which is a negative pressure lab room. Even with that, if a lab worker gets infected working in the BL4 lab, it can break out.

I imagine there is intense debate about the types of virology R&D that it's safe to be doing. One strategy would be to include something in the genetic mods that disables viral replication inside cells. That way, the virus could be worked with in a form that is pandemic-proof.

Ironically, we shut down our Asian collaboration of Health Experts the very year we needed it most. We have routinely watched the development of VIruses around the world for about two decades now, recognising that no country is an Island (New Zealand, you suck)

Every flu vaccine administered in the US has its origins in science starting 12 months prior, when we educated guesses as to which strains will be the threat to public health - a complicated convolution of virulence and infection rate.

Its typical that the Media pumps stories about the dangers of Ebola - a nasty looking disease, easily controlled. Meanwhile, 50,000 die of flu in a bad year, and 600,000+ in a horrible year.
